Some good news has arrived for AC Milan and Sergio Conceicao in view of the derby against Inter on Wednesday night in the Coppa Italia.
As La Gazzetta dello Sport (seen below) report this morning, Milan were immediately back to work yesterday in view of the Coppa Italia derby. Back from the trip to Napoli, Conceiçao’s men trained in the afternoon at Milanello, in the presence of Zlatan Ibrahimovic and Geoffrey Moncada.
There is good news regarding Thiaw, who – after missing the match at the Maradona due to a virus – immediately returned to the group. It is likely that the German will resume his place in the centre of defence, alongside Matteo Gabbia (favoured over Strahinja Pavlovic).
Ruben Loftus-Cheek, on the other hand, is definitely absent, having undergone appendicitis surgery in Naples. The Englishman will have to rest completely for two weeks and will only be available after four.
However, Conceiçao will have Yunus Musah back against Inter, who was suspended at the weekend. The American could be deployed as a starter in a formation with Youssouf Fofana, Tijjani Reijnders, Christian Pulisic and Rafael Leao.
The Portuguese winger, who started on the bench against Napoli, will have the task of helping Santiago Gimenez, a striker in crisis. For Santi it will be his first Milan derby, after he watched from the stands in the last one played in February.
